WEDDINGS/CELEBRATIONS: VOWS

POREBA FALLS, an intimate playwriting workshop for Harvard graduates, faintly evokes a misty haven for honeymooners, but it did not inspire so much as a whiff of interest between Francesca Delbanco and Nicholas Stoller when they met there in 2001.

At the time of the workshop, held that year at a rented house in Idewild, Calif., they were involved with other people. And then there was Mr. Stoller's appearance.

"I had a beard, and she didn't like it," said Mr. Stoller, 29, whose first produced movie project, "Fun With Dick and Jane," written with Judd Apatow and starring Jim Carrey and Téa Leoni, is to open in December.

Ms. Delbanco, whose first novel, "Ask Me Anything," about the romantic travails of a struggling actress in New York, was published last year by W.W. Norton, is a charter member of the Poreba workshop, which began 10 years ago in the Berkshire Mountains home of the Poreba family. Although she and Mr. Stoller overlapped at Harvard, where he wrote for The Harvard Lampoon, they didn't meet until he joined the invitation-only workshop.

At its meeting the next year, in a house in New Lebanon, N.Y., Mr. Stoller arrived cleanshaven and unattached.

"He walked in the door, and the first thing I said was, 'I had forgotten how tall you were,"' Ms. Delbanco, 31, recalled. "We flirted all weekend."
